About Me!
I am deeply passionate about photography, travel and snacks! Unbeetable Photography is the result of my devotion to all three.
I grew up in both Tuolumne county and the Central Valley of California. Though I have always been interested in the arts, photography did not find me right away. In my younger days I focused mainly on painting and illustration. I moved to Northern California to study graphic design and illustration at Humboldt State University (Now Cal Poly Humboldt) After graduating I started working in the marketing department of The North Coast Co-op. When my boss asked if I was willing to learn food photography for our marketing material, I responded with an enthusiastic “Sure.” It wasn’t long before I fell in love with photography and food photography in particular.
Since then I have taken my Nikon all over the world! Taking photos for restaurants in Mexico, Guatemala, Vietnam and Chicago!
